California residents question open gates after fire forces evacuations on Fourth of July
By Conor McGill Click here for updates on this story LINCOLN, California (KOVR) — Residents in a Lincoln neighborhood are praising the quick response of firefighters after a brush fire forced them to evacuate on the Fourth of July, but many are now questioning why gates leading into the development were left open during the holiday.
